Essential Factors to Consider in Book Printing

Embarking on the journey of book printing demands careful consideration of various essential factors. Firstly, pinpoint your budget and align it with printing costs. Paper grade plays a pivotal role in the overall look and feel of your book. Furthermore, select a suitable binding style such as perfect binding or saddle stitching, based on the size and content of your book. Typography and layout significantly impact readability, so choose fonts and spacing that are legible. Don't forget to factor in cover design and printing, as it serves as the initial impression of your book. Lastly, proofread meticulously before finalizing your manuscript to confirm a polished and professional product.
